In August, we held an offline alliance leader gathering.
We rented two villas and forty-one alliance leaders came, gathering for three days and two nights. We chatted about writing experiences, plots, and the fate of everyone and Chi Xin. Many people wrote short essays, pouring out their innermost feelings with the help of wine, saying how much they liked this story, and I was deeply moved. I, who never smoked or drank, also inevitably drank cup after cup.
This gathering started being discussed at the beginning of the year. In the alliance group, everyone gathered their available times, and finally, most people felt that August 12th was a good time.
Similar gatherings had been held before, but that was already two years ago.
Given everyone's understanding of my writing speed, they originally expected me to take leave during the gathering. They also all expressed that they would help me cover for it and withstand readers' scolding.
At that time, we didn't expect that *Chi Xin Xun Tian* could actually get first place, and that it would be achieved in July, just before the gathering.
Taking leave right after getting first place would inevitably create suspicion of putting on airs...
To maintain continuous updates, I crazily stockpiled manuscripts. While they were singing, playing board games, gaming, playing billiards... I was finding places everywhere to write and revise text.
I stayed up until three or four in the morning and still took out my notebook in the morning.
Fortunately, I still relatively completely achieved my writing goals.
During the gathering, everyone also had many ideas and said some words about bitter endings followed by sweet ones, but no one expected that the results in August could actually be even better.
Throughout August, we dominated the bestseller list.
On July 31st, the average order was thirty-seven thousand seven hundred. On August 31st, the average order reached forty-four thousand two hundred.
This August felt a bit dreamlike. A book with six million eight hundred thousand words increased by six thousand five hundred average orders in one month.
This month, we also won first place in monthly tickets.
Frankly speaking, I was a bit stunned.
I think besides everyone's support for this book and the reward of monthly ticket red envelopes from the five-star glory event, it also lies in the fact that the previous six million eight hundred thousand words of this novel were indeed written with heart.
I poured my emotions into the words and lines, and the readers perceived it. During those times that were unknown to others, my struggles with some readers were seen by more readers.
The recent dozens of new alliances are mostly new readers who just started. This shows that this novel, which has been serialized for nearly four years, is still continuously attracting new readers.

I am a very confident person, but the current results of *Chi Xin Xun Tian* do not mean we can close the coffin and conclude that this is an excellent work.
At most, we can only say that the previous six million eight hundred thousand words were indeed written with heart, but how the subsequent writing will be still remains to be seen.
I always believe that the most important part of a novel is its ending.
Only when we see the complete three words "Full Book Complete" can we comprehensively review this book—does it have a good beginning and a good end? Does it build a complete world? Is it worthy of the expectations borne along this journey?
When we read, we want to see the spirit from beginning to end. We want to see the stars in the sky forming a bouquet of flowers, and thousands of threads finally becoming a ceremonial robe.
Ancient people painting said, "painting a dragon and dotting the eyes." Without the last stroke, the painted dragon cannot come to life.
I am not sure I can do well, but I will still do as I promised when I first started the book—I will exhaust all my efforts.
The story has progressed to now. Wang Zai can already look up and see the view from the absolute peak. The pit in the Xue He Sect is almost filled. The handwriting of various saints is known to people, and the veil of the near ancient era has also been lifted.
